SR Linux ، نظام تشغيل شبكة نوكيا الجديد لأجهزة التوجيه

نوكيا كشفت في الآونة الأخيرة تم تقديم نظام تشغيل شبكة جديد يسمى «راوتر خدمة لينوكس»(SR Linux) الذي يصف كيف نظام يركز على استخدام مراكز البيانات والبيئات السحابية في البنية التحتية للشبكة.

لينكس SR تعتبر مكونًا رئيسيًا في حلول Nokia Data Center النسيج وسيتم تثبيته على أجهزة التوجيه Nokia 7250 IXR و 7220 IXR. يتم بالفعل اختبار الحل المستند إلى SR Linux في مركز البيانات الدنماركي الجديد التابع لشركة Apple.

حول SR Linux

على عكس أنظمة التشغيل الأخرى لمعدات الشبكة القائمة على Linux kernel ، يحتفظ SR Linux بالقدرة على الوصول إلى بيئة Linux الأساسية ، أن لم يتم إخفاءه خلف واجهات برمجة التطبيقات والواجهات المتخصصة.

يمكن للمستخدمين الوصول إلى النواة Linux غير المعدلة وتطبيقات النظام الأساسية (bash و cron و Python وما إلى ذلك) و lيتم إنشاء تطبيقات محددة باستخدام NetOps Toolkit ، وهو غير مرتبط بلغات برمجة معينة.

تكتسب التطبيقات المستندة إلى NetOps Toolkit ، مثل تطبيقات بروتوكول التوجيه ، إمكانية الوصول إلى واجهات برمجة تطبيقات مختلفة للشبكة ، ولكنها تعمل كمكونات منفصلة.

يتيح لك هذا الأسلوب إدارة التطبيقات بشكل منفصل عن النظام.للتشغيل ، على سبيل المثال ، يمكنك تحديث التطبيق دون إجراء تغييرات على النظام أو تحديث نظام التشغيل دون إعادة بناء التطبيقات.

بالإضافة إلى التطبيقات القياسية ، مثل تنفيذ بروتوكولات التوجيه ، يُسمح بتشغيل برامج الجهات الخارجية التعسفية.

يؤدي استخدام Linux kernel غير المعدل إلى تبسيط الصيانة إلى حد كبير من التصحيحات مع القضاء على نقاط الضعف وإنشاء المكونات الإضافية. القدرة المعلنة على الوصول إلى أدوات Linux المساعدة والتصحيحات والحزم ، بالإضافة إلى دعم الإصدار في حاويات معزولة. دعم لتحديد نقاط التوقف لعكس التغييرات في حالة حدوث مشاكل.

يمكن أن تتم الإدارة من خلال gNMI (واجهة إدارة شبكة gRPC) ، واجهة خط الأوامر، وملحقات Python ، وواجهة برمجة تطبيقات JSON-RPC.

للوصول إلى وظائف الخدمات التي تعمل على النظام ، يُقترح استخدام gRPC و Protocol Buffers.

يمكن لتطبيقات SR Linux تبادل البيانات الحالة باستخدام بنية النشر / الاشتراك (pub / sub) ، والتي تستخدم أيضًا gRPC و Protocol Buffers ، وتستخدم IDB (قاعدة بيانات Nokia Impart) كآلية تسليم مضمونة.

لهيكلة المعلومات حول حالة التطبيق المستخدم وتكوينه ، يتم استخدام نماذج بيانات YANG (جيل جديد آخر ، RFC-6020).

تعتمد تطبيقات بروتوكول الشبكة ، بما في ذلك بروتوكول بوابة الحدود متعدد البروتوكولات (MP-BGP) و Ethernet VPN (EVPN) و Extensible Virtual LAN (VXLAN) ، على مكدس بروتوكولات SR OS (نظام تشغيل خدمة Nokia) الذي تم تنفيذه بالفعل في أكثر من مليون جهاز توجيه Nokia لتلخيص مكونات الأجهزة ، يتم استخدام طبقة Nokia XDP (مسار البيانات القابل للتوسيع).

لأتمتة العمليات إنشاء ونشر وتكوين البنية التحتية لشبكة مركز البيانات ، وجمع وتحليل القياس عن بعد ، عرضت منصة خدمات النسيج من نوكيا (PSF).

FSP أيضا يوفر أدوات محاكاة شبكة البرامج لتبسيط تخطيط الشبكة وتصميمها واختبارها وتصحيح الأخطاء في مراكز البيانات. مكونات الشبكة تمت محاكاته باستخدام عزل الحاوية بناءً على منصة Kubernetes، والذي يسمح لك بتشغيل مثيلات فردية من SR Linux في بيئات الحماية الخاصة بك.

المضمون، يتيح لك FSP إنشاء نسخة افتراضية من شبكة حقيقية برمجيًا واستخدم نفس البرنامج (SR Linux في الحاويات) المستخدم في أجهزة التوجيه والمحولات الحقيقية في هذه الشبكة المحاكاة. بالإضافة إلى ذلك ، تستخدم الشبكة الحقيقية والمحاكية نفس الإعدادات ، مما يسمح لك باستخدام شبكة محاكاة برمجية كالرابط الأول لإجراء التغييرات واختبارها.

استنادًا إلى بيئة محاكاة ، يمكن لـ FSP إنشاء جميع المعلومات اللازمة لتنفيذ شبكة حقيقية.

إذا كنت تريد معرفة المزيد عنها ، يمكنك الرجوع إلى بيان Nokia الرسمي بالانتقال إلى للرابط التالي.


اترك تعليقك

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ها ب *

*

*

  1. المسؤول عن البيانات: AB Internet Networks 2008 SL
  2. الغرض من البيانات: التحكم في الرسائل الاقتحامية ، وإدارة التعليقات.
  3. الشرعية: موافقتك
  4. توصيل البيانات: لن يتم إرسال البيانات إلى أطراف ثالثة إلا بموجب التزام قانوني.
  5. تخزين البيانات: قاعدة البيانات التي تستضيفها شركة Occentus Networks (الاتحاد الأوروبي)
  6. الحقوق: يمكنك في أي وقت تقييد معلوماتك واستعادتها وحذفها.

  1.   ألان هيريرا قال

    ما هي لغات البرمجة؟

    لا تثق ، تذكر أن Nokia مملوكة لشركة Microsoft